Transaction 37e750db3625197d638a8fe5494302123bed1ce51bc97bca3ea84d3ed53e3a9b

1 Input
2 Outputs
  • 37e750db3625197d638a8fe5494302123bed1ce51bc97bca3ea84d3ed53e3a9b:0
  • value  4763
    address  18s5vnrbxWQ5tLjJC91Kg5fymx3BcG4Taj
  • 37e750db3625197d638a8fe5494302123bed1ce51bc97bca3ea84d3ed53e3a9b:1
  • value  348967
    address  17kSyLTVYEV9WbAsqfUgMUYYiaU1YVSBEE